DielS-Alder(DA)反应是一类二烯和亲二烯体进行的[4 + 2]环加成反应。基丁 DA反应及其逆过程的自修复聚合物材料近年来在形状记忆材料、可修复涂层、药物输送以及电子封装等领域取得广泛应用。DA反应制备自修复聚合物时通常使用含呋喃基团的化合物或低聚体作为二烯,马来酰亚胺化合物作为亲二烯体。其它的二烯-亲二烯体系如蒽-马来酰亚胺和环戊二烯-双环戊二烯等也被报道用来做自修复材料。本文根据二烯和亲二烯体的不同结构,综述了基于 DA反应的自修复聚合物材料研究进展及应用,并探讨了其潜在发展方向。
